How Much Does Well Pump Repair Cost in New Site?

Well pump repairs in New Site cost $300 to $1,500, depending on problem severity and pump depth. Pressure switch and tank repairs are less expensive than motor replacements or pulling deep pumps. We diagnose accurately and recommend cost-effective solutions including repair versus replacement options.

How Long Do Well Pumps Last in New Site Conditions?

Well pumps in New Site typically last 10 to 15 years with proper maintenance. Lifespan depends on water quality, usage frequency, and pump quality. Regular pressure tank maintenance and proper electrical protection extend pump life. We service all pump types for optimal longevity.

What Are Common Signs That My Well Pump Needs Repair in New Site?

Signs include no water flow, low pressure, constant cycling, unusual noises, or air in lines. Pressure tank issues and tripped breakers also indicate problems. Our New Site technicians diagnose pump system issues thoroughly and provide effective repair solutions restoring reliable water service.
